#fd9d4d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#fd9d4d is composed of 99.2% red, 61.6%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.9% magenta, 69.6%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 27.3 degrees, a saturation of 97.8% and a lightness of 64.7%. #fd9d4d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ff9a with #fb3b00. Closest websafe color is: #ff9966.

#fd9d4d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#fd9d4d has RGB values of R:253, G:157, B:77 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.7, K:0.01. Its decimal value is 16620877.

Shades and Tints of #fd9d4d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100700 is the darkest color, while #fffdfc is the lightest one.
